HyperBowling is a completely new way of bowling. You play on a real bowling lane, but with HyperBowling, it’s not just about hitting the pins. In one throw, you first hit the glowing LED targets along the lane and then the pins. By hitting the glowing targets, you can increase your score by up to 4 times! In HyperBowling, each pin knocked down earns you 100 points. For example, if you hit a green target first and then knock down 4 pins, you double your score to 800 points (4 x 100 x 2 = 800). Different levels and challenges make HyperBowling harder and more exciting. HyperBowling is fast-paced and more active than traditional bowling.

Game rules & safety

  1. Be ready to bowl when the pins have been set, but wait until the machine has completed its cycle and the red light is off.
  2. Always wait for the bowler to your right if you’re both ready to bowl at the same time. Just like in traffic, right has priority!
  3. Do not stand on the bowling lane while you’re waiting. Be ready when it’s your turn and don’t make others wait.
  4. Respect the boundaries of the bowling lane and do not obstruct other bowlers.
  5. Play the game to win, but be a better loser.

Yes, bowling shoes are required. Yes, bowling shoes are mandatory. Regular shoes can damage the lanes, so we provide special bowling shoes with felt soles. They let you slide just the right amount, safe and smooth. These shoes are made for bowling!
